I’m diving head first,
ground rises up to meet me—
we land; nightmare ends.

Flowers in waiting;
fist rain drops of the season
drifting overhead.

Raining down blessings,
brightening up pepper trees—
summertime sunshine.

Buzzing airport lights;
seeking a different high,
solo traveller.

We make those buildings
constellation defying,
masking our night skies.
